If you’re one of those Clash Royale players who thinks Rocket needs a stat boost, it looks like the folks at Supercell have heard those pleas. And this letter started the event with the main character in a surprising way.
Rocket has not only changed his stats, but also his mechanics, becoming an improved version of the Goblin Excavator. For now, since that card can only be used in the Rocket Threat Challenge, Clash Royale players can fulfill their dream: taking down the King’s Tower in the blink of an eye.

With the game mechanics presented in this new challenge in mind, we’ve created a fast bike deck, why? The rocket in question is so powerful that it can destroy the king’s tower only 4 times.
Similarly, this card can only attack the central tower, so you have to leave two other defensive towers, because it is useless to spend elixir on these structures (defending this rocket is very complicated, only the monk can deal with it).
Deck 1 – Hunter Monk
Rocket.Skeletons (evolved).Fire Spirit.Monk.Tornado.Ice Spirit.Electric Spirit.Shock.
Tower Card: Princess.
Average elixir consumption: 2.6 units.
